Re: SIP Broker access

Thanks DCurrey... I did some digging on the SIPBroker.com site and they suggested pretty much the same thing. They even claim if you pass a number to @sipbroker.com and it does not pass the number should go out via your VoIP service. I haven't played much with it, but if that's the case then the dialplan would be fine.

Also, for those that don't mind long dial strings, if you have family/friends outside your local calling area, SIPBroker has many local numbers that can be dialed and then *5071NxxNxxxxx should put them on your VT service. I haven't tested this out so there may be some exceptions, but these days, cost savings are welcomed where ever they show up.
